Effects of Active and Passive Intervention Programs Applied to Patients' Necks on Their Muscular Strength, Muscular Endurance, and Joint Range of Motion

[Purpose] The purpose of this study was to conduct a passive intervention program and an active intervention program for healthy subjects for six weeks, and analyze and compare their effects on the neck's muscular strength and endurance and the joint range of motion (ROM). [Subjects] This study selected 28 undergraduates as subjects and allocated them randomly and equally to either the passive intervention program group (PIPG) or the active intervention program group (AIPG). [Methods] The cranio-cervical flexion test (CCFT) was modified to measure the deep neck flexor (DNF)'s strength and endurance, and the cervical range of motion (CROM) was measured to compare and analyze flexion, extension, right lateral flexion (RLF), left lateral flexion (LLF), right rotation (RR), and left rotation (LR) of the neck. [Results] Both the PIPG and the AIPG showed significant improvements in the measured items post-intervention. In a comparison of the two groups, strength, endurance, flexion, and extension in the AIPG were significantly better than their respective values in PIPG. [Conclusion] In treating deep neck flexors, an active intervention program is more effective than a passive intervention program at improving muscular strength, muscular endurance, and joint ROM. ^g>Passive intervention, Active intervention, Deep neck flexor
机译:[目的]本研究的目的是对健康受试者进行为期六周的被动干预计划和主动干预计划,并分析和比较它们对颈部肌肉力量和耐力以及关节活动范围(ROM)的影响。 [对象]该研究选择了28名本科生作为研究对象,并将其随机且均等地分配给被动干预计划组(PIPG)或主动干预计划组(AIPG)。 [方法]改良颅颈屈曲试验(CCFT)以测量深颈屈肌(DNF)的强度和耐力,并测量颈椎运动范围(CROM)以比较和分析屈曲,伸展,右侧颈部屈曲(RLF),左侧屈曲(LLF),右旋(RR)和左旋(LR)。 [结果]干预后,PIPG和AIPG的测量项目均显着改善。在两组的比较中,AIPG的强度,耐力,屈伸性和伸展性明显优于PIPG中的各自值。 [结论]在治疗深颈屈肌方面,主动干预计划比被动干预计划在改善肌肉力量,肌肉耐力和关节ROM方面更为有效。 ^ g>被动干预,主动干预,深屈肌
